Lady Elizabeth Morrison has secretly desired her best friend her entire life, but she detests his rakish ways that make him unfit for marriage. When he wagers that he can give up his ways in seven days, Elizabeth agrees, only to find that the path to true love is never smooth.

Jonathan Howell, the Duke of Norwood, lives a scandalous life but has only ever loved one woman, his alluring friend, Elizabeth. However, when an insufferably perfect lord sets his sights on her, Jonathan knows he must act quickly or risk losing the love of his life forever.

As their passion ignites and hidden enemies close in, Jonathan and Elizabeth must prove that their burning love can rewrite their story. Will seven days be enough to change a rake’s heart, or will it all end in heartbreak?

Tropes: (Childhood) Friends to Lovers, Reforming the Rake, Scandalous bargain/arrangement

"Seven Days to Win a Lady's Heart" is a historical romance novel of approximately 60,000 words. No cheating, no cliffhangers, and a guaranteed happily ever after.
